Debra Hedges to Provide Estate Planning Strategies for Seniors in Three Free Panels This May
This May, Partner Debra Hedges will speak in three free-to-attend “Aging Well” panels, aimed at equipping seniors with real-world strategies to protect and manage their estate, whether they are just getting started or revisiting an existing plan:
- Norfolk Council on Aging will host the first panel on Tuesday, May 5 from 1:00 p.m. to 2:30 p.m. at 28 Medway Branch, Norfolk, MA 02056.
- Wellesley Neighbors will host the second panel on Wednesday, May 6 from 3:30 p.m. to 5:00 p.m. at the Wellesley Free Library, 530 Washington Street, Wellesley, MA 02482.
- Mansfield Council on Aging will host the third panel on Wednesday, May 13 from 10:30 to 11:30 a.m. at 255 Hope St., Mansfield, MA 02048.
In her panels, Deb will highlight how comprehensive estate plans keep seniors’ assets and interests protected. Three local experts in assisted living, real estate, and home remodeling will join her to cover key senior living topics such as downsizing decisions, maximizing a home sale, aging-in-place remodeling considerations, and other independent living options.
